Mad Men Vs The Hour


Mad Men


The Hour

I think TV is about to get interesting....

I am in Singapore and not even I can escape the lure of another vintage style drama set in 1950s Britain. 
The Hour looks set to be a great BBC drama with Hollywood heavyweights like Dominic West (The Wire) leading the cast, what can go wrong? 
Of course you simply cannot mention the 50s without Mad Men coming up into conversation, it seems Mad Men has become the "50s" which is crazy as it is set in 1960, based in a Manhattan ad agency and features housewives who look like they are stepping onto a catwalk not a kitchen. Whereas The Hour is set in the UK, set in 1956 when rationing was dying out, based in a TV news station and features women who ARE trying to work in a man's world. Confused? 


Mad Men


The Hour

Too similar? Can't wait? I will definitely try and watch - mainly for the fashion and accessories, but hopefully I shall stay for the drama, cast and authenticity to the era. You know they have only just begun filming series 5 of Mad Men, we may as well enjoy ourselves whilst we wait no?

Pan Am to Rival Mad Men?


Are you getting excited for the TV series "Pan Am?" Pan Am is the Sony produced drama that is airing this Fall on ABC. Set to rival shows like "Mad Men" and "Boardwalk Empire."




Pan Am is the 1960s - set drama that revolves around the pilots and flight attendants of the once iconic airline. When being an Air Stewardess was one of the most glamorous occupations. It was a time when air stewardesses were proud to welcome passengers on board and when passengers were proud to travel. Expect lots of girdles, cheeky passenger requests, crew gossip, secrets and inflight entertainment.




The show will feature many familiar faces including Margot Robbie (neighbours), Michael Mosley (Scrubs) and star Christina Ricci (Mermaids, Addams Family.) 


Christina Ricci was photographed filming for the show in Manhattan this past week wearing a bright prom dress. The cast and crew of Pan Am are being spotted everywhere this month as they film on location for the show. What do you think? Will you be watching?

Mad Men Nail Polish


You all know by now I have had Mad Men fever since the show started in 2007. I spread the word wherever I go and I have occasionally been known to stop talking to someone who has not seen the show. I mean it is the best thing since sliced bread for gawds sake!
Since the show began the fever of Mad Men has been spreading like a wild fire and I am here to announce it has now reached epidemic proportions. With a Barbie doll range, a QVC fashion line, a Banana Republic inspired collection Janie Bryant is the queen of multi tasking and branding.
Janie Bryant is the costume designer behind Mad Men and she is fast becoming the spokesperson for the show. Bryant is the woman who we depend upon to create and ensure Mad Men is authentic and as accuarte as possible to the era and characters. If this seasons catwalk trends are anything to go by, Janie is now the woman we depend on to inspire our very own wardrobes. Everyone wants a piece of Mad Men! Who can argue with Louis Vuitton and Prada?
Janie Bryant somehow seems to still find time on her hands as she has collaboarated with the nail polish brand Nailtini to create a collection of four limited edition nail shades inspired by Mad Men. Bryant says she was inspired by the fabrics of the era, velvet, satins, and lamé. The fabrics that go in to make a glamorous cocktail dress. The colours will be; Bourbon Satin, French 75, Deauville and Stinger. The shades will include browns, golds, a platinum and an iridescent.
The bad news is these shades will only be available in the US. Although I have heard on the grapevine nail polish brand; Essie are thinking of producing a Mad Men collection? Yet to be confirmed, but if you know anything please tell me!
